Before you start making any adjustments, make sure your machine is turned off and unplugged. Safety should always be your number one priority. You don't want any accidental starts while you're tinkering with the settings.

Now, let's talk about the parts of the machine that are involved in adjusting the chamfering depth. Most pipe chamfering machines have an adjustment knob or a dial. This is usually located near the chamfering tool or on the control panel. The knob or dial is connected to a mechanism that moves the tool closer or farther from the pipe surface.

To start the adjustment process, you'll need to measure the desired chamfering depth. You can use a caliper or a depth gauge for this. Let's say you need a chamfering depth of 2mm. Once you've measured and noted down the required depth, it's time to start turning the adjustment knob.

If you're using a machine like the PBM - 20, the adjustment is usually quite smooth. Turn the knob slowly in the direction that will move the chamfering tool closer to the pipe. As you turn, you'll notice that the tool starts to move. Keep an eye on the measurement device you're using to ensure you're getting closer to your desired depth.

It's important to make small adjustments at a time. If you turn the knob too much at once, you might overshoot your desired depth. And then you'll have to start the adjustment process all over again. So, take it slow and steady.

After making a small adjustment, you can test the chamfering on a scrap piece of pipe. This is a great way to check if you're on the right track. Clamp the scrap pipe in the machine just like you would a regular pipe. Then turn on the machine and let it do its thing for a few seconds.

Once the test is done, take a look at the chamfered edge of the scrap pipe. Use your measurement tool to check the depth. If it's too shallow, you can go back and make another small adjustment to the knob. If it's too deep, turn the knob in the opposite direction to move the tool farther from the pipe.

Another thing to keep in mind is the material of the pipe. Different materials can affect the chamfering process. For example, softer materials like aluminum might require a slightly different adjustment compared to harder materials like stainless steel. So, always consider the material when making your depth adjustments.

If you're having trouble getting the right depth, it could be due to a few reasons. One common issue is a dull chamfering tool. A dull tool won't cut as effectively, and it might give you inconsistent results. So, make sure to regularly check the condition of your chamfering tool. If it's dull, replace it with a new one.

Another possible problem could be a misaligned tool. Check to see if the chamfering tool is properly installed and aligned. If it's not, it can cause the depth to vary across the pipe. You can usually adjust the alignment by loosening the screws that hold the tool in place and then re - positioning it. Make sure to tighten the screws securely once you've got the right alignment.

Now, let's talk about some tips to make the adjustment process even easier. First, document your settings. Keep a record of the adjustment knob position for different chamfering depths and pipe materials. This way, if you need to make the same chamfer again in the future, you won't have to start from scratch.

Second, practice makes perfect. Don't be afraid to experiment with different settings on scrap pipes. The more you practice, the better you'll get at adjusting the chamfering depth quickly and accurately.
